MT 30 LAB – H 3 years, 11 months ago The digestive system is made up of the gastrointestinal (GI) tract and the liver, pancreas, and gallbladder. The GI tract is a collection of hollow organs that are connected to one another from the mouth to the anus. The organs that make up the GI tract, in order of connection, are the mouth, esophagus, stomach, small intestine, large intestine, and anus.The digestive system is designed specifically to convert food into the nutrients and energy needed for a person to survive. When that’s done, it handily packages the body’s solid waste, or stool, for disposal when a person has a bowel movement.
